Multiply as indicated and express the answer in lowest terms.
4/a^4 times a/8

4(a)
---- {multiply, horizontally, across numerators and denominators}
a^4(8)

4a
--- {multiplied}
8a^4

1
---- {cancelled/reduced}
2a^3
